#d1943b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1943b is composed of 82% red, 58%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.2% magenta, 71.8%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 35.6 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 52.5%. #d1943b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ff76 with #a32900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#d1943b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0702 is the darkest color, while #fefc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1943b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878685 is the less saturated color, while #f69b16 is the most saturated one.
